Coloring tips: How to color Panda Bear In Raincoat coloring page well?
For the panda, you can use classic black and white colors. The raincoat can be bright yellow, blue, or red for a cheerful look. The umbrella could match the raincoat or be a contrasting color like green or purple to add variety. The raindrops can be a soft blue or light gray. Make the puddle a light blue shade to resemble water, while the ground can be a gentle brown for the earth. Encourage creativity by allowing kids to use any colors they like!
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Panda Bear In Raincoat coloring page?
1. Color Blending: Achieving a good blend between colors can be challenging. When coloring the panda, avoiding hard lines will help in mixing whites and blacks smoothly. 2. Small Details: The panda's facial features have small areas that require attention. Filling in the eyes and mouth carefully is important to keep the panda’s expression friendly. 3. Umbrella and Raincoat: Deciding on colors for these items can be confusing. Kids may struggle to choose colors that work well together. 4. Staying Within Lines: Beginners might have difficulty staying within the lines, especially in the small details of the panda’s coat and the raindrops. 5. Overall Composition: Balancing colors throughout the page so they complement each other can be tricky for young artists.
